4 days ago

Product Security Developer

MaintainX

On Site
Full Time
$160,000
Ontario, CA

Job Overview

Job TitleProduct Security Developer
Job TypeFull Time
CategoryCommerce
Experience5 Years
DegreeMaster
Offered Salary$160,000
LocationOntario, CA

Who's the hiring manager?

Sign up to PitchMeAI to discover the hiring manager's details for this job. We will also write them an intro email for you.

Uncover Hiring Manager

Job Description

Product Security Developer at MaintainX

MaintainX is the world's leading Asset and Work Intelligence platform for industrial and frontline environments. We are a modern IoT-enabled cloud-based tool for reliability, safety, and operations on physical equipment and facilities. MaintainX powers operational excellence for 13,000+ businesses including Duracell, Univar Solutions Inc., Titan America, McDonald's, Brenntag, Cintas, Xylem, and Shell.

We recently completed a $150 million Series D round, bringing our total funding to $254 million and valuing the company at $2.5 billion.

MaintainX’s mission is to be the go-to work execution platform for manufacturers across Maintenance, Operations, and Safety. Our Security Team plays a critical role in enabling this mission by ensuring the integrity, confidentiality, and availability of our systems, data, and products.

We are looking for a Product Security Developer to join our growing Security Team. This role is a hands-on engineering position focused on designing, building, and integrating security solutions across the MaintainX stack. You will collaborate with multiple product and infrastructure teams to embed security into everything we build and operate.

As part of the Security Team, you’ll report to the Security Lead and work on initiatives that improve the overall security posture of MaintainX, from secure coding practices and internal tooling to automation and vulnerability management.

What You’ll Do

  • Design and implement security-focused features across our stack (TypeScript, React, Node.js, GraphQL, AWS) in collaboration with product, platform, and DevOps teams.
  • Develop internal security tooling to automate vulnerability detection, dependency management, and compliance validation.
  • Perform secure code reviews and contribute to improving developer security awareness through tooling and education.
  • Integrate security scanning and observability tools into CI/CD pipelines to ensure continuous protection and visibility.
  • Contribute to incident response and threat modeling efforts, helping to identify risks and propose mitigations at the application and infrastructure layers.
  • Collaborate with engineering and infrastructure teams to implement secure-by-design patterns and strengthen authentication, authorization, and data protection mechanisms.
  • Continuously evaluate and enhance the security architecture for MaintainX’s cloud environment.
  • Contribute to security documentation, playbooks, and standards that align with our compliance frameworks (SOC 2, ISO 27001, etc.).

About You

  • 3+ years of professional software development experience with TypeScript, Node.js, and web technologies.
  • Experience developing or integrating security solutions (e.g., SAST/DAST, vulnerability management, authentication systems, secrets management, identity services).
  • Strong understanding of web application security principles (OWASP Top 10, secure session handling, input validation, XSS/CSRF prevention).
  • Familiarity with cloud security concepts (IAM, network segmentation, encryption, logging).
  • Ability to write maintainable, testable, and secure code.
  • Strong communication skills and ability to partner with product, engineering, and compliance teams.
  • Demonstrated experience working in fast-paced, modern cloud environments.

Nice to Have

  • Experience with React Native and/or GraphQL security considerations.
  • Knowledge of AWS security services (IAM, KMS, GuardDuty, WAF, etc.).
  • Familiarity with DevSecOps pipelines and CI/CD automation (GitHub Actions, CircleCI).
  • Prior experience contributing to or leading security automation or hardening initiatives.
  • Certifications such as OSCP, CSSLP, or AWS Security Specialty are a plus.

What’s In It For You

  • Competitive salary and meaningful equity opportunities.
  • Healthcare, dental, and vision coverage.
  • 401(k) / RRSP enrollment program.
  • Take what you need PTO.
  • A Work Culture where:
    • You’ll work alongside folks across the globe that reflect the MaintainX values, Smart Humble Optimist.
    • We believe in meritocracy, where ideas and effort are publicly celebrated.

About Us

Our mission is to deliver one platform for maintenance, repair & operations teams to keep the physical world running. We believe the greatest asset in any organization is the people. That’s why we built an intuitive, mobile-first solution to help boost productivity and collaboration across teams and locations.

MaintainX is committed to creating a diverse environment. All qualified applicants will receive consideration for employment without regard to race, colour, religion, gender, gender identity or expression, sexual orientation, national origin, genetics, disability, age, or veteran status.

Key skills/competency

  • Product Security
  • Web Application Security
  • TypeScript
  • Node.js
  • AWS
  • CI/CD
  • Vulnerability Management
  • Secure Code Review
  • DevSecOps
  • Incident Response

Tags:

Product Security Developer
Security Engineering
Vulnerability Management
Secure Code Review
Incident Response
Threat Modeling
Compliance
Automation
Cloud Security Architecture
DevSecOps
Data Protection
TypeScript
Node.js
React
GraphQL
AWS
CI/CD
GitHub Actions
SAST
DAST
Identity Services

Share Job:

How to Get Hired at MaintainX

  • Research MaintainX's culture: Study their mission, values, recent news, and employee testimonials on LinkedIn and Glassdoor.
  • Tailor your resume: Highlight experience with TypeScript, Node.js, AWS security, and DevSecOps, matching job requirements.
  • Showcase security expertise: Prepare to discuss web application security principles like OWASP Top 10 and cloud security.
  • Emphasize collaboration: Share examples of cross-functional teamwork with engineering, product, and DevOps teams.
  • Demonstrate problem-solving: Discuss how you've identified risks and implemented mitigations in cloud environments.

Frequently Asked Questions

Find answers to common questions about this job opportunity

Explore similar opportunities that match your background